I was thinking about building my own center console for my 94 sport. Has anyone done this? I was thinking about adding a pistol safe to it or at least a lock. I also was thinking a screen on the back with a slight tilt up and a few switches in the front for lights and such. Any ideas on how to. I was thinking thin MDF and speaker box carpet. I have never done fiberglass and I am kind of a perfectionest so trying something new will just frustrate me. Thanks in advance.

I have a friend who made one out of MDF and then covered it in a cheap leather like material. He just stretched the material over it and stapled it in place from the bottom. He used a basic cabinet lock from Lowes to secure valuables.
I'm about to start on one for myself. I want 2 cup holders big enough for Nalgenes.

I have 6 switches on my centre concole lid.
Looks kinda cool wthe arm rest to reveil bright red switches underneath, they are as follows

- Run1 (Ignition coil, alternator, Blower)
-Run2 ( Windows, Wipers..)
-Start (Crank)
-Stereo
-Lights
-Power Inverter
